Benzoicacid, p-nitro-, octyl ester (7CI,8CI); 1-Octyl 4-nitrobenzoate; Octyl4-nitrobenzoate; Octyl p-nitrobenzoate; n-Octyl p-nitrobenzoate
Please post your buying leads,so that our qualified suppliers will soon contact you!
Country - Code Area - Code Number